Technical Details of TRENDnet TI-R4U

  • Model: TI-R4U 19" Rackmount Vertical Power Supply Chassis
  • Compatibility: Designed to house up to four TI-RSP100048 industrial power supply units (sold separately)
  • Rack Unit (RU) size: 2U
  • Mounting: Front-access, open-frame vertical chassis compatible with standard 19" racks
  • Material: Durable steel enclosure for enhanced rigidity and vibration resistance
  • Slots: 4 x PSU slots (for TI-RSP100048 PSUs)
  • Power supply not included: TI-RSP100048 units sold separately
  • Ventilation: Open-frame design to maximize airflow and cooling efficiency
  • Color and finish: Factory steel finish designed for industrial environments
  • Applications: Ideal for data centers, industrial automation, telecom closets, and rugged network deployments

how to install TRENDnet TI-R4U

  • Prepare the rack: Ensure the rack is stable, properly grounded, and capable of supporting 2U height with the intended PSU weight. Verify that the vertical space allows full access to the TI-R4U for installation, maintenance, and cable management.
  • Mount the chassis: Slide the TI-R4U into a 19" rack and align it with the mounting rails. Secure the chassis using the appropriate rack screws at the top and bottom mounting holes to lock it in place, ensuring the front panel remains accessible for PSU installation and servicing.
  • Install TI-RSP100048 PSUs: Insert up to four TI-RSP100048 units into the four PSU slots. Follow the TI-RSP100048 installation guidelines for proper seating, connector engagement, and securing hardware. Ensure each PSU is firmly seated and that any retainers or latches are engaged to prevent movement during operation.
  • Connect power and cooling: Route power cables to each TI-RSP100048 unit according to your organization’s electrical and safety standards. Confirm that cooling fans (if present on the PSUs) have clear airflow paths and that the open-frame chassis maintains adequate clearance around the unit for optimal ventilation.
  • Cable management and labeling: Tidy cables using ties or dedicated channels to prevent accidental disconnections and to simplify future maintenance. Label each PSU slot for quick identification during servicing or replacements.
  • Power-on verification: With all PSUs installed and connected, power up the rack and verify that each TI-RSP100048 unit is detected and delivering the expected rails and voltages. Check for overheating indicators, unusual noises, or warning LEDs. Perform a basic load test to confirm stable operation under representative conditions.
